Walk route: Braithwaite - Kinn - Sleet How - Grisedale Pike - Hopegill Head - Sand Hill - Coledale Hause - Grasmoor - Eel Crag (Crag Hill) - Sail - Sail Pass - Force Crag Mine - Coledale - Braithwaite

Distance: 10.25 miles

Ascent: 4,100ft

Click here for a map of the route

Time: 5 hours 40 minutes

With: Anne

Conditions: Blue sky and sunshine once we climbed above the fog. Warm when out of the wind
